Quick context for your review: the Fernhollow profile store is sharded by user region across twelve partitions, managed by our Splitkit tool. If the shard-admin account gets locked mid-rebalance (it happens more than we'd like), recovery goes through the Splitkit CLI, not the web UI. The CLI prompts once, and the accepted recovery passphrase is noted just below.

recovery phrase for fajep-yaweg: gilath-sorox-wenius-rusdor-keliel-zorius

Handover — DispatchWeave heuristic

For your review: the driver-assignment heuristic in DispatchWeave scores candidates on proximity, shift remaining, and historical acceptance. Scores are computed in-process; no external calls. Weights are operator-tunable, which is the main audit surface — changes aren't yet gated by approval. Logs capture every override. Everything else is read-only. The live tuning configuration is listed below.

deployment values, kajep-kageg:
[praix]
host = praix.paliqcorp.corp
user = praix_svc
database = praix_prod

Welcome to on-call for the Glimmerpane design system! Our snapshot tests live in the `snapcheck` suite and run on every merge to main. If a UI component changes visually, the diff bot flags it — usually it's an intentional tweak, so just approve the new baseline. If it's 2am and snapshots are failing across the board, it's almost always a font-loading race, not your problem. To unlock the baseline store and re-approve snapshots in bulk, use the recovery passphrase below.

recovery phrase for tahag-taguf: wenix-caswyn